An Environmental Impact Statement (EIS) is required for any federal project that has significant impact on the environment. The EIS process is required under the National Environmental Policy Act (NEPA) and is used to evaluate the potential environmental impacts of a proposed federal action. The EIS process requires the lead agency to study the proposed action, consider alternatives to the proposed action, and assess the potential environmental impacts of each alternative. The EIS process also requires public input and consultation with other agencies before a final decision is made on the proposed action.
NEPA requires Federal agencies to prepare environmental impact statements (EISs) for major Federal actions that significantly affect the quality of the human environment.

There are various types of foundation phase classroom contexts, but let's compare two common ones: traditional classroom settings and Montessori classrooms.

In a traditional classroom, the teacher takes a central role in imparting knowledge to the students. The curriculum is structured and standardized, typically following a set syllabus.

The teacher delivers lessons to the whole class, and students are expected to follow instructions, complete assignments, and take tests. Advantages of this context include: clear structure, standardized curriculum, familiarity for teachers, emphasis on discipline, and preparation for more traditional educational settings.

However, disadvantages can include limited individualized attention, restricted creativity, potential for boredom, less hands-on learning, and limited student autonomy.

In contrast, Montessori classrooms focus on child-centered learning and hands-on experiences. Children have freedom of choice in selecting activities and work at their own pace. Montessori teachers act as facilitators and guides.

Advantages of Montessori classrooms include individualized learning, hands-on experiences, self-directed learning, development of independence, and fostering creativity.

However, disadvantages may include less structured curriculum, potential for lack of focus, challenges in transitioning to more traditional settings, limited emphasis on standardized testing, and potential for insufficient teacher guidance.

It is important to note that both contexts have their own strengths and weaknesses, and the choice between them depends on the needs and preferences of the students, parents, and educators involved.

"Pelléas et Mélisande" is an opera composed by Claude Debussy, with a libretto based on the play by Maurice Maeterlinck.

How to explain the information

The story revolves around the love triangle involving Pelléas, Mélisande, and Golaud. Pelléas and Mélisande are the main characters in the opera.

Pelléas is a young man, the half-brother of Golaud, a prince from the kingdom of Allemonde. Mélisande is a mysterious and enigmatic woman. They come to know each other when Golaud discovers Mélisande in a forest, weeping by a spring. Mélisande is lost and fearful, and Golaud takes her back to the castle, eventually marrying her. However, Mélisande and Pelléas develop a deep emotional connection, which leads to tragedy.

The cycle represented in this image is the Carbon cycle.

What is the  Carbon cycle?

The carbon cycle is the biogeochemical cycle that exchanges carbon between Earth's biosphere, pedosphere, geosphere, hydrosphere, and atmosphere. Carbon is the most abundant element in biological molecules, as well as in numerous rocks such as limestone.

The carbon cycle describes how carbon moves between various 'carbon reservoirs' (or carbon sinks) on Earth. It is critical for our planet's temperature and carbon balance to remain stable.

"The Rite of Spring" (1913) is a ballet and orchestral concert work composed by Russian composer Igor Stravinsky. The piece is known for its avant-garde style and its controversial premiere, which caused a riot among the audience.

Three important features of "The Rite of Spring" are:

1. Rhythm: The piece features complex and irregular rhythms, which were unusual for classical music at the time. Stravinsky used a technique called "ostinato," which involves repeating a short musical phrase over and over again with slight variations. This creates a sense of tension and excitement, as the rhythm builds and changes throughout the piece.

2. Tone color: Stravinsky used a large orchestra with a wide variety of instruments to create a rich and colorful sound. He also experimented with unusual combinations of instruments, such as the bassoon and contrabassoon, to create unique tone colors. The piece features many extended techniques, such as glissandos and pizzicato, which add to the unusual and innovative sound of the music.

3. Pitches: The piece features dissonant and atonal harmonies, which were also unusual for classical music at the time. Stravinsky used a technique called "polytonality," which involves layering multiple different keys on top of each other. This creates a sense of ambiguity and tension, as the listener is not always sure which key the music is in. The piece also features many sharp and angular melodies, which add to the sense of tension and excitement in the music.
